namespace gdjs {
interface BevelFilterExtra {
/** It's defined for the configuration but not for the filter. */
distance: number;
}
interface BevelFilterNetworkSyncData {
r: number;
t: number;
d: number;
la: number;
sa: number;
lc: number;
sc: number;
}
gdjs.PixiFiltersTools.registerFilterCreator(
'Bevel',
new (class extends gdjs.PixiFiltersTools.PixiFilterCreator {
makePIXIFilter(target: EffectsTarget, effectData) {
const bevelFilter = new PIXI.filters.BevelFilter();
return bevelFilter;
}
updatePreRender(filter: PIXI.Filter, target: EffectsTarget) {}
updateDoubleParameter(
filter: PIXI.Filter,
parameterName: string,
value: number
) {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
if (parameterName === 'rotation') {
bevelFilter.rotation = value;
} else if (parameterName === 'thickness') {
bevelFilter.thickness = value;
} else if (parameterName === 'distance') {
bevelFilter.distance = value;
} else if (parameterName === 'lightAlpha') {
bevelFilter.lightAlpha = value;
} else if (parameterName === 'shadowAlpha') {
bevelFilter.shadowAlpha = value;
}
}
getDoubleParameter(filter: PIXI.Filter, parameterName: string): number {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
if (parameterName === 'rotation') {
return bevelFilter.rotation;
}
if (parameterName === 'thickness') {
return bevelFilter.thickness;
}
if (parameterName === 'distance') {
return bevelFilter.distance;
}
if (parameterName === 'lightAlpha') {
return bevelFilter.lightAlpha;
}
if (parameterName === 'shadowAlpha') {
return bevelFilter.shadowAlpha;
}
return 0;
}
updateStringParameter(
filter: PIXI.Filter,
parameterName: string,
value: string
) {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
if (parameterName === 'lightColor') {
bevelFilter.lightColor = gdjs.rgbOrHexStringToNumber(value);
}
if (parameterName === 'shadowColor') {
bevelFilter.shadowColor = gdjs.rgbOrHexStringToNumber(value);
}
}
updateColorParameter(
filter: PIXI.Filter,
parameterName: string,
value: number
): void {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
if (parameterName === 'lightColor') {
bevelFilter.lightColor = value;
}
if (parameterName === 'shadowColor') {
bevelFilter.shadowColor = value;
}
}
getColorParameter(filter: PIXI.Filter, parameterName: string): number {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ter;
if (parameterName === 'lightColor') {
return bevelFilter.lightColor;
}
if (parameterName === 'shadowColor') {
return bevelFilter.shadowColor;
}
return 0;
}
updateBooleanParameter(
filter: PIXI.Filter,
parameterName: string,
value: boolean
) {}
getNetworkSyncData(filter: PIXI.Filter): BevelFilterNetworkSyncData {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
return {
r: bevelFilter.rotation,
t: bevelFilter.thickness,
d: bevelFilter.distance,
la: bevelFilter.lightAlpha,
sa: bevelFilter.shadowAlpha,
lc: bevelFilter.lightColor,
sc: bevelFilter.shadowColor,
};
}
updateFromNetworkSyncData(
filter: PIXI.Filter,
data: BevelFilterNetworkSyncData
) {
const bevelFilter = filter as unknown as PIXI.filters.BevelFilter &
BevelFilterExtra;
bevelFilter.rotation = data.r;
bevelFilter.thickness = data.t;
bevelFilter.distance = data.d;
bevelFilter.lightAlpha = data.la;
bevelFilter.shadowAlpha = data.sa;
bevelFilter.lightColor = data.lc;
bevelFilter.shadowColor = data.sc;
}
})()
);
}
